Overview:

Captain Barber spent the daylight hours of the 28th reorganizing his perimeter for the renewed Chinese attacks he was sure would come with darkness. To this end, he was re-supplied by airdrop with ammunition, grenades, medical supplies and coils of barbed wire. His men used the time to dig in further, even stacking enemy dead to act as quasi-sandbags around their fighting holes. A light helicopter dropped off vital batteries for the radio that gave his forward observer a link to a battery of 105mm howitzers in Hagaru-ri. Barber ensured that these guns were pre-registered. From the enemy’s perspective, it was vital that they secure the pass so as to bottle up the 5th and 7th Marines to thus enable their comrades in arms to destroy some 7,000 Marines in detail. The only means of escape for the Marines was through the pass that Fox Company, now at just over half-strength, guarded. At 2200 hours the crackle of a loudspeaker brought with it a patronizing voice in near perfect English calling on the Marines to surrender. After several minutes of this speech a large bonfire erupted along the enemy tree line near the rocky knoll. In the firelight could be seen the silhouettes of dozens and dozens of Chinese soldiers clad in their distinctive quilted jackets and trousers carrying out some form of war dance. As the embers died down to a glow so too did the Chinese political officer’s heated psychological warfare efforts.
